Output cd367306a243d123de3f151e5cca07bf93abce8d086f9e091e6846087fd7128b:0

value
1504981
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7cf897f97d55a50b2a202441c016651e802ac3ba OP_EQUALVERIFY OP_CHECKSIG
address
1CPnbNqymihNqXCQejX5NkizrCHgwwpkq9
transaction
cd367306a243d123de3f151e5cca07bf93abce8d086f9e091e6846087fd7128b
confirmations
347643
spent
true